Dell Laptop Series: A Breakdown of the Key Lines

Dell has an extensive range of laptop models, each tailored to different user needs. Here’s a breakdown of some of the most popular series in Dell’s laptop lineup:

1. Dell XPS Series: Premium Ultrabooks and Productivity Powerhouses

The Dell XPS series is known for its premium build quality, stunning displays, and exceptional performance. These laptops are a go-to choice for professionals, creatives, and anyone looking for a top-tier ultrabook.

  • Best For: Professionals, content creators, and users who need a powerful yet portable device.
  • Key Features:
    • Sleek, all-metal design with minimal bezels.
    • Stunning 13-inch, 15-inch, and 17-inch displays with options for 4K or OLED screens, offering incredible color accuracy.
    • Powered by Intel’s latest Core processors (i5, i7, i9) and ample RAM (up to 32GB).
    • Excellent battery life (up to 12-15 hours depending on usage).
    • High-quality audio and camera features.
    • Thin and lightweight, making it ideal for those who need a portable laptop.

The Dell XPS 13 is a standout model, offering all the features of a high-end ultrabook, with a beautiful InfinityEdge display and an ultra-portable design. The XPS 15 and XPS 17 are great options if you need more screen real estate or higher processing power for tasks like video editing or gaming.

2. Dell Inspiron: Affordable Laptops for Everyday Use

The Dell Inspiron series is designed for budget-conscious consumers who need a reliable laptop for everyday tasks. While it’s more affordable than Dell’s premium models, the Inspiron still offers solid performance, making it a great choice for students, home users, and anyone looking for a laptop for work, study, or entertainment.

  • Best For: Budget-conscious users, students, and casual consumers.
  • Key Features:
    • A range of configurations with Intel Core i3, i5, i7, and AMD Ryzen processors.
    • HD and Full HD display options (some models have touchscreen displays).
    • Ample storage and RAM, with configurations typically ranging from 4GB to 16GB of RAM and 128GB to 1TB of SSD storage.
    • Stylish designs with vibrant colors and finishes.

The Inspiron 14 and Inspiron 15 are popular models, providing a balance of value and performance. For a more versatile option, the Inspiron 2-in-1 models allow users to switch between laptop and tablet modes, adding extra flexibility.

3. Dell Latitude: Business-Class Laptops with Enterprise Features

The Dell Latitude series is designed for business professionals who need a reliable, durable, and secure laptop for work. These laptops offer enterprise-grade features like advanced security, long battery life, and premium support options. The Latitude series is ideal for companies that require a fleet of machines for their workforce.

  • Best For: Business professionals, enterprise users, and anyone needing a durable and secure laptop.
  • Key Features:
    • Durable, military-grade construction with spill-resistant keyboards and reinforced frames.
    • Enterprise-level security features, including Dell’s ProSupport, TPM 2.0, and optional fingerprint readers.
    • A range of sizes, from ultra-portable 13-inch models to larger 15-inch and 17-inch options.
    • Long battery life (up to 12+ hours) with fast-charging technology.
    • Configurations with Intel Core i5, i7, and i9 processors, plus options for SSD storage and ample RAM.

The Latitude 5000 and Latitude 7000 series are popular among professionals and businesses due to their reliable performance, durability, and security features.

4. Alienware: Gaming Laptops for Ultimate Performance

For gamers who need high-performance hardware and immersive experiences, Alienware is Dell’s flagship gaming laptop brand. These laptops are designed to handle the most demanding games and applications with ease, offering powerful processors, high-end GPUs, and advanced cooling systems.

  • Best For: Gamers, streamers, and content creators who demand top-tier performance.
  • Key Features:
    • Powerful Intel Core i7/i9 and AMD Ryzen 7/9 processors.
    • High-performance NVIDIA GeForce RTX graphics for smooth gaming experiences.
    • High-refresh-rate displays (120Hz, 144Hz, or more) for smoother gameplay.
    • Advanced cooling technology to prevent thermal throttling during intense gaming sessions.
    • Stunning RGB lighting and customizable options for a personalized gaming setup.

The Alienware X17 and Alienware m15 R6 are two of the top models, offering excellent gaming performance in a sleek design. These laptops can handle the latest AAA titles at high settings without breaking a sweat.

5. Dell Precision: Workstations for Professionals and Creatives

The Dell Precision series is designed for users who require workstations that can handle resource-intensive tasks like 3D rendering, video editing, CAD design, and scientific computing. These laptops are built to offer desktop-level performance in a portable form factor.

  • Best For: Engineers, architects, designers, and professionals who need powerful workstations for demanding tasks.
  • Key Features:
    • Equipped with Intel Xeon or Core i9 processors and up to 128GB of RAM.
    • Professional-grade NVIDIA Quadro or AMD Radeon Pro graphics cards.
    • Color-accurate, high-resolution displays (up to 4K) for visual professionals.
    • Durable and built for heavy workloads, with ISV (Independent Software Vendor) certifications for specific software.

The Dell Precision 5000 and Precision 7000 series are ideal for those who need powerful, reliable laptops for professional-grade work.


Performance, Display, and Battery Life: What to Expect from Dell Laptops

1. Processors:
Dell laptops feature both Intel and AMD processors, offering a range of performance options for various users. Intel Core i3/i5/i7/i9 processors and AMD Ryzen 3/5/7/9 chips are common across Dell’s lineup, ensuring excellent performance for everything from basic tasks to gaming and professional work.

2. Display Options:
Dell is known for offering some of the best displays in the laptop industry. Many of its premium laptops, such as the XPS 13 and Alienware series, feature 4K displays with outstanding color accuracy and wide viewing angles. Dell also offers touchscreen and OLED display options for an enhanced user experience.

3. Battery Life:
Battery life varies depending on the model, but Dell laptops are generally known for offering strong endurance. Premium ultrabooks like the XPS 13 can last up to 12-15 hours, while gaming laptops like the Alienware m15 typically offer 6-8 hours of use on a full charge.
